Deshpande is an Indian cricketer who has played for the Indian national cricket team, making his debut in July 2024 against Zimbabwe. He has also represented Mumbai in domestic cricket and has been a part of the Rajasthan Royals and Chennai Super Kings in the Indian Premier League. He bowls medium seam and made his IPL debut in 2020. In February 2022, he was bought by Chennai Super Kings in the 2022 Indian Premier League auction. Tushar's journey is marked not only by his achievements on the field but also by the personal battles he has fought. In 2017, his mother, Vandana Deshpande, was diagnosed with ovarian cancer. Despite the emotional toll, Tushar continued to pursue his cricketing aspirations. Tragically, she passed away in 2019 while he was playing in the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y Super League. Tushar's journey is also marked by personal relationships. Nabha Gaddamwar, an Indian arts instructor, captured the attention of many when her engagement to Tushar was announced in June 2023. Their relationship, which began with a school crush, exemplifies his personal life and the connections he has made beyond cricket.
